1868 Fla. Laws 2538

Abstract
Persons Engaged in Criminal Offence, Having Weapons, ch. 7, § 10: Prohibited the carrying of a slungshot, metallic knuckles, billies, firearms or other dangerous weapon if arrested for committing a criminal offence or disturbance of the peace. Punishable by imprisonment up to 3 months or a fine up to $100.
